Proposal

Details of condition 17 'Materials' as required by planning permission ref no. 22/AP/1068 'Redevelopment of site to provide a 24 storey building plus basement consisting of purpose-built student accommodation (Sui Generis), and commercial uses (Use Class E) at ground floor, and the development of the associated railway arches to provide commercial space (Use Class E), plant, refuse and cycle storage, and associated access and public realm works'.
